The rating level feature works in conjunction with DVDs that have
been assigned a rating level, and helps you to control the types of
DVDs that your family watches.
1.
Press the SETUP button on the remote control.

If the Rating
Level Feature
Doesn't
Work
In order
for the Rating level feature
to work, the disc must be encoded
with the proper
rating
information.
If the maker
of the disc did not
encode rating
information,
then this
feature
will not work properly.
